Humanity First

They called it 'The Outbreak'. Such a pitiful name for something that would shatter the world into a thousand pieces, decimating the population, and even pull technology itself to a screaming halt as the world tried to reorganise its life.

Humanity, however, is ever-resilient. The same traits that allowed us to become the dominant species on the planet ensured that we survived what was once thought to be its end. New countries and nations emerged, new powers and leaders of the desperate and hopeless sprung up from the cracks in the Earth.

In New Australia, a new government was created with the creed 'Humanity First'. These two words became the rallying cry of the people. A new world rose from the ashes of the old where people could live again and where a human could be born and live their life free in the knowledge that they need never fear the horrors of The Outbreak.

Finally, humans were safe from the zombies.

Everyone understood that the price of safety is freedom. However, what could be said is that the New Australia's city-states effectively run by Humanity First were very, very safe.

As for freedom, though, well…, that was another matter entirely.
